This is a brand-new role with Align, giving you the opportunity to develop the role and support the lead Transport Planner in establishing a dedicated team of planners & engineers.


This position offers the opportunity to work on diverse projects, coll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, and contribute to the growth and success of our transportation planning initiatives.

You will be responsible for establishing best practices, driving innovation, and contributing to the success of our Highway Schemes and range of development projects.


You will use your experience to deliver Transport Statements, Assessments, Travel Plans, check roundabout and junction capacity, provide preliminary highway design input and arrange traffic count and speed data for a wide range of schemes.

Using transportation software packages of your choice, you will work with our Architects, Highways, Civils & Structural Engineers to deliver a wide range of both public and private sector projects.

To be successful in this position, you will be able to demonstrate the following essential skills and qualifications:

  • Degree in Civil Engineering or equivalent with post-qualification experience
  • Proven record delivering LCWIPS, Local Travel Plans, Transport Assessments/Statements, Active Travel Report, Junction / Roundabout capacity modelling.
  • High level junction & highway design including adoption knowledge. Deep knowledge of the regulatory system to ensure that designs and projects comply with relevant laws and regulations.
  • Proficiency in engineering software tools such as Autocad, ARCADY/PICADY, LINSIG, TRICS, TEMPRO, PARAMICS, SATURN, PDS Line and Sign etc.
  • To work effectively in a newly formed team, and build strong working relationships
  • Able to communicate effectively with clients, stakeholders, and regulatory authorities
  • Engage in activities involved in staying up to date with the latest advancements, technologies, and industry trends to provide cuttingedge solutions and maintain your expertise.
  • Membership with ICE / IHE /CIHT or working towards membership.
  • Full UK driving licence
